The alarm began setting itself off after they updated all of the door modules for the second time. During the first seven week visit, they updated all the door modules. Then Ford came out with newer updates, so they did them all again with the newest updates before returning the car to me. Within three days the alarm triggered itself twice. They are saying it’s showing as a passenger rear door module. The collaborating Ford engineer told the tech just to replace both rear modules just to be sure. That’s all I know.Door modules triggering alarms is likely software, ask you dealer to run the door module updates and see if that fixes it. I don't think the modules need to be replaced.
